Fabric and Color Pairing Strategies

One of the most exciting aspects of testing Sleeping Floral Deer Embroidery is determining its versatility across different fabrics. On neutral sweatshirts like oatmeal, cream, or heather grey, this design will likely pop beautifully if paired with earth-toned thread colors. Think sage greens, dusty roses, and deep browns to enhance the woodland aesthetic. However, the design also holds promise for dark fabrics. Placing this motif on charcoal or navy blue hoodie design bases can create a striking contrast, provided the lighter thread shades are selected to highlight the deer's features.

For pastel colorways, such as blush pink or lavender, the floral elements in the design can be matched closely to the fabric to create a subtle, tonal effect. This approach works exceptionally well for custom apparel targeting a younger demographic or those seeking a softer, more minimal look. The key here is ensuring the stitch density is sufficient to prevent the design from getting lost against light-colored threads on light-colored fabric. Always test a sample to verify that the definition remains crisp.

Practical Designer Concerns and Technical Execution

From a technical standpoint, there are several factors to consider before running this commercial embroidery design on a production line. First, assess the stitch density relative to the fabric thickness of your sweatshirts. Heavyweight fleece may require a cutaway stabilizer to support the weight of the embroidery without puckering. If the design is too dense for a thin jersey knit, it could cause distortion, so adjusting the settings in your digitizing software might be necessary.

Thread color contrast is another critical element. Ensure that the chosen palette provides enough distinction between the deer and the background florals. Poor contrast can make the design appear muddy, reducing the perceived value of the item. Additionally, check the small-size readability if you plan to offer this as a logo-sized patch. Intricate floral details may blur if scaled down too aggressively. Always review the printable mockup at actual scale to confirm clarity.

Washing durability is a concern for any apparel decorator. The stitching should be secure enough to withstand repeated laundering without fraying. Using high-quality thread and proper tension settings will ensure longevity. Finally, remember that Sleeping Floral Deer Embroidery is a digital asset.
